Not really though. There are plenty of very talented Mississippi players that haven’t been properly evaluated because of the lack of camps this year. Mississippi is usually very under evaluated by recruiting services because of the lack of coverage. There are multiple 3 stars that are probably more 4* caliber.




This is true. There are several 4 star talents that are currently under ranked, which is not unusual for Mississippi, but the recruiting scouts have not done any work here lately. Some of these players are juco. Why Ole Miss doesn't recruit MS jucos harder is probably because it won't help their ranking, which is what they hang their hat on. But it would make them better on the field, which is what actually counts.
